    SLVU925B – April 2014 – Revised July 2014 bq76930 and bq76940 Evaluation Module User's Guide The bq76930EVM evaluation module (EVM) is a complete evaluation system for the bq76930, a 6-cell to 10-cell Li-Ion battery analog front end (AFE) integrated circuit. The bq76940EVM evaluation module (EVM) is a complete evaluation system for the bq76940, a 9-cell to 15-cell Li-Ion battery analog front end (AFE) integrated circuit.

    The Read Device button at the top of the Registers view provides important setup of the bq76940/bq76930/bq76920 software and the IC. The software reads the factory gain and offset data from the device and populates these in the Stack V/T/I section for use in calculating display values. The software writes the CC_CFG register to its proper value and also detects the CRC mode of the device and sets the software appropriately.

    4.4.8 Operation with Other Interfaces or Hosts The bq76940/bq76930/bq76920 software does not support other interface boards or adapters other than the EV2300 and EV2400. The software does not operate in a multi-master environment. If operated with another host on the line, data collisions can occur. Also be aware that the EV2400 has internal pull up resistors to 3.3 V, connecting to some shared busses could damage devices on that bus if the bus voltage...

    Connecting to a Host After initial operation of the AFE with the bq76940/bq76930/bq76920 software, it may be desirable to operate the board connected to a microcontroller board. J14 can be used to connect to the microcontroller board. No voltages should be applied to the gauge terminals. Alternately, the microcontroller could be connected to the signal test points or J8 and the ALERT test point.
